Los Angeles, CA: Dorothy Adler Routh Publications, 1975 Book. Very Good - Fine. Hardcover. First Edition. 4to. Dust Jacket Condition: Very Good ++. xvi, 83 pp, introduction, preface, list of over 80 color illustrations, Early History; Materials and Colors; Chart of Color Development; Chart of Color Development; Color Fold-out Chart of How Cloisonnes are Made; Characteristics of Ming Wares; The Cloisonne Emperors; Ormolu and Later Additions; Imperial Settings for Cloisonne; The Imperial Workshop; Altarpieces in Cloisonne; Brass versus Copper; Glossary and index; Animals in Cloisonne; Chinese Export; Repousse; "Openwork" versus Repousse; Snuff Bottles; History of Japanese Cloisonne; Japanese Cloisonne Today; Champleve Enamels; bibliography, acknowledgments & credits. Color photography by Tomoo Ogita. Presumed First Edition, 1975. 3/4" triangle chip to bottom edge front panel dj with partially rubbed edges along dj spine, and slightly foxed fore-edges at dj flaps. Lightly foxed text block edges with only the faintest wear, else, Pristine. Clean, tight and strong binding with no underlining, highlighting or marginalia. Blue leatherette with gilt lettering to spine..
